Burger
Form patties
Divide the ground beef into one 4 oz portion. Gently shape into a patty about 3.5 inches (9 cm) wide and about 1/2 inch (1.3 cm) thick. Avoid overworking the meat to keep the patty tender. Make a shallow dimple in the center with your thumb to reduce puffing while cooking.
Season
Season both sides of the patty evenly with 1/8 tsp black pepper and 1/4 tsp salt just before cooking.
